Troubleshooting

Lock doesn't turn with the key.

Ensure the key is fully inserted and try applying gentle pressure while turning. Check for any obstructions within the lock mechanism.

Lock is difficult to close.

Check for any obstructions or misalignment between the lock components. Make sure the window closes properly and is not warped.

Key gets stuck in the lock.

Try lubricating the lock mechanism with a graphite lubricant. If the key is broken, carefully remove the broken piece or contact a locksmith.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

Setup

  1. Preparation: Ensure the window frame and sash are clean and dry before installation.
  2. Positioning: Align the lock components on the window frame and sash, ensuring proper alignment for locking.
  3. Installation: Secure the lock components using the provided screws. Follow the manufacturer's instructions for proper placement and alignment.
  4. Testing: Test the lock with the key to ensure smooth operation and secure locking.

Compatibility

  • Window Type: Specifically designed for hinged wooden windows.
  • Window Frame: Compatible with most standard wooden window frames.

Care

  • Cleaning: Wipe the lock with a damp cloth to remove any dirt or debris.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ners.
  • Lubrication: Periodically apply a small amount of lubricant to the locking mechanism to ensure smooth operation.
